Semiconductors The Basics of Silicon, Diodes And Transistors
Semiconductors have played a massive role in society for quite some time. They're in the middle of microprocessor chips, transistors and anything computerized. Almost every semiconductor today is made from silicon. A common element, silicon could be the main ingredient in sand and quartz.

With four electrons rolling around in its outer orbital, silicon includes a unique property in the electron structure that enables it to make crystals. Just like a carbon's crystalline can form as diamond, silicon's crystalline form is really a silvery substance that's metallic to look at.

Basic Semiconductors: What's a Diode?

By combining the N-type and P-type silicon together, an interesting event comes about. The N-type and P-type silicon together forms a "diode." Diodes would be the simplest varieties of semiconductors then when positioned correctly, they can transmit electrical current. However, diodes allow household current to flow within one direction. In other words, diodes block household current in one direction while letting current flow in another.

Diodes could be found in many different applications. One example involves integrating diodes within devices who use batteries. These devices could have a diode for protection in the event batteries are inserted backward. In this instance, the diode will block current from leaving it and protects the device's sensitive electronic components.
